Output 5896fef80bf466a7c43fe1442f29eb5620f5a889049fcb97014c9ebaeb4b5556:5

value
120272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c86473b19b8541d8e7cc782030e62f9b06d69dd7 OP_EQUAL
address
3KxbQS2DMtZFhpHkTWtt5vV6a7PtS58Ysv
transaction
5896fef80bf466a7c43fe1442f29eb5620f5a889049fcb97014c9ebaeb4b5556
spent
true